Internet Computers vs. Traditional Cloud: What's the Difference?

The shift toward decentralized technologies has brought about a significant emerging approach in computing: Internet Networks. While both offer solutions for hosting data , they work in fundamentally different ways. Traditional platforms , like Amazon Web Platform, copyright, and Google Cloud, rely on centralized server farms owned and administered by a particular company . This gives them substantial influence over usage . In comparison , Internet Machines distribute processing power across a vast decentralized network of independent nodes , essentially creating a distributed computing layer .

This core distinction impacts everything from security and confidentiality to censorship and development.
